IdentityFlow for ServiceNow streamlines identity verification (IDV) within your service desk, empowering your organization to verify the true identities of customers, employees, and partners—essential for building trust online while protecting against social engineering, phishing, account takeover attacks, fraud, and data breaches.
Verify User Identity - Deploy advanced biometrics, liveness detection, and document proofing to enforce high-fidelity identity verification for service desk users. Stop social engineering attacks, account takeovers, and fraud before they enter your system.
Accelerate Agent Performance - Enable automated self-verification workflows that validate users without agent intervention. Remove complexity and pressure from agents, allowing them to focus on delivering exceptional customer service.
Customize Your Workflows - Integrate identity verification into any incident or request workflow. Configure triggers and automation logic to align with your specific business objectives.
Create Seamless Experiences - Deliver fast, frictionless verification that’s easy to manage and reuse across your organization.
Active IdRamp account is required to processes IDV requests.
- Configurable Verification: Allows customization to suit different verification needs.
- Automatic & Manual Modes: Flexibility to trigger verifications either automatically or manually.
- Post-Verification Actions: Enables setting record values upon successful verification completion.
- Status Tracking: User-friendly interface to monitor the verification status with ease.
- Visibility Groups: Specify groups whose members will be able to see the button to create verification requests in manual mode.
- Service Operations Workspace: The manual mode button is available in the Service Operations Workspace.
- Confirmation Diaog: Review and change if needed User Verification Details prior Verification triggering
- Verification Status: Added visibility of the verification status on verification requests.
- Group Requests by UserID: Verification requests could be grouped by UserID for easier tracking and management.
- Custom Communication Channel Selection: Users can now choose between custom Email and Phone fields for communication.
- Masked Communication Details for Agents: A confirmation dialog now could mask communication details when viewed by agents (if configured in configuration record)
- User Attributes Mapping: User attributes received after verification can now could be mapped to corresponding data record fields. Attributes and values are displayed under Verification Request Related List. Mapping is available in corresponding Config record.
- Toggle Work Notes for Verification Requests: Disable/Enable Verification Request creation work notes
- Multiple Setting Profiles: Support for multiple setting profiles, allowing each config to use distinct connection settings.
